Not All Stuffy in Those Days.

I rediscovered this old album today. It is in a sorry state. It was in a garage for a few years, and it shows. It belonged to my father's grandmother.

She had lost a husband when she was quite a young mother of four children. She did not think she could replace my great grand father, but after a while she met a wonderful man and they ended up getting married.

They went on a very long honeymoon, to wonderful places, some wild and unsophisticated, some smart. There are descriptive and very affectionate captions to a lot of the photographs.

She had this album made up and dated for the time they had away.

I love that she called it Happiness. That is so un Victorian. She wanted everyone to know. And I love that I, as a descendant many many years later I can see this evidence of such a good time, and a very good match. So I don't just put it in a pile, thinking, 'Oh, a load of old photos, interesting, but.."
